成人性生交大片免费看视频r_亚洲综合极品香蕉久久网_在线视频免费观看一区_亚洲精品亚洲人成人网在线播放_国产精品毛片av_久久久久国产精品www_亚洲国产一区二区三区在线播_日韩一区二区三区四区区区_亚洲精品国产无套在线观_国产免费www

主頁(yè) > 知識(shí)庫(kù) > 在ORACLE中SELECT TOP N的實(shí)現(xiàn)方法

在ORACLE中SELECT TOP N的實(shí)現(xiàn)方法

熱門(mén)標(biāo)簽:外呼系統(tǒng)好點(diǎn)子 地圖標(biāo)注的坐標(biāo)點(diǎn) 區(qū)域地圖標(biāo)注怎么設(shè)置 百度地圖標(biāo)注注解 上海網(wǎng)絡(luò)外呼系統(tǒng) 百度地圖標(biāo)注飯店位置怎么 電話機(jī)器人那種好 理財(cái)產(chǎn)品電銷(xiāo)機(jī)器人 南通電銷(xiāo)外呼系統(tǒng)哪家強(qiáng)

  1.在Oracle中實(shí)現(xiàn)SELECT TOP N

   由于ORACLE不支持SELECT TOP語(yǔ)句,所以在ORACLE中經(jīng)常是用ORDER BY跟ROWNUM的組合來(lái)實(shí)現(xiàn)SELECT TOP N的查詢(xún)。

 簡(jiǎn)單地說(shuō),實(shí)現(xiàn)方法如下所示:

 SELECT 列名1...列名n FROM
  (SELECT 列名1...列名n FROM 表名 ORDER BY 列名1...列名n)
  WHERE ROWNUM = N(抽出記錄數(shù))
 ORDER BY ROWNUM ASC

   下面舉個(gè)例子簡(jiǎn)單說(shuō)明一下。

 顧客表customer(id,name)有如下數(shù)據(jù):

  ID NAME
   01 first
   02 Second
   03 third
   04 forth
   05 fifth
   06 sixth
   07 seventh
   08 eighth
   09 ninth
   10 tenth
   11 last

   則按NAME的字母順抽出前三個(gè)顧客的SQL語(yǔ)句如下所示:

 SELECT * FROM
  (SELECT * FROM CUSTOMER ORDER BY NAME)
  WHERE ROWNUM = 3
  ORDER BY ROWNUM ASC

   輸出結(jié)果為:

  ID NAME
   08 eighth
   05 fifth
   01 first

2.在TOP N紀(jì)錄中抽出第M(M = N)條記錄

 在得到了TOP N的數(shù)據(jù)之后,為了抽出這N條記錄中的第M條記錄,我們可以考慮從ROWNUM著手。我們知道,ROWNUM是記錄表中數(shù)據(jù)編號(hào)的一個(gè)隱藏子段,所以可以在得到TOP N條記錄的時(shí)候同時(shí)抽出記錄的ROWNUM,然后再?gòu)倪@N條記錄中抽取記錄編號(hào)為M的記錄,即使我們希望得到的結(jié)果。

 從上面的分析可以很容易得到下面的SQL語(yǔ)句。

SELECT 列名1...列名n FROM
   (
   SELECT ROWNUM RECNO, 列名1...列名nFROM
    (SELECT 列名1...列名n FROM 表名 ORDER BY 列名1...列名n)
   WHERE ROWNUM = N(抽出記錄數(shù))
  ORDER BY ROWNUM ASC
   )
  WHERE RECNO = M(M = N)

 同樣以上表的數(shù)據(jù)為基礎(chǔ),那么得到以NAME的字母順排序的第二個(gè)顧客的信息的SQL語(yǔ)句應(yīng)該這樣寫(xiě):

 SELECT ID, NAME FROM
   (
   SELECT ROWNUM RECNO, ID, NAME FROM
    (SELECT * FROM CUSTOMER ORDER BY NAME)
     WHERE ROWNUM = 3
     ORDER BY ROWNUM ASC )
    WHERE RECNO = 2

     結(jié)果則為:

   ID NAME
    05 fifth

3.抽出按某種方式排序的記錄集中的第N條記錄

   在2的說(shuō)明中,當(dāng)M = N的時(shí)候,即為我們的標(biāo)題講的結(jié)果。實(shí)際上,2的做法在里面N>M的部分的數(shù)據(jù)是基本上不會(huì)用到的,我們僅僅是為了說(shuō)明方便而采用。   

   如上所述,則SQL語(yǔ)句應(yīng)為:

SELECT 列名1...列名n FROM
   (
   SELECT ROWNUM RECNO, 列名1...列名nFROM
    (SELECT 列名1...列名n FROM 表名 ORDER BY 列名1...列名n)
     WHERE ROWNUM = N(抽出記錄數(shù))
   ORDER BY ROWNUM ASC
   )
   WHERE RECNO = N

     那么,2中的例子的SQL語(yǔ)句則為:  

 SELECT ID, NAME FROM
   (
    SELECT ROWNUM RECNO, ID, NAME FROM
     (SELECT * FROM CUSTOMER ORDER BY NAME)
    WHERE ROWNUM = 2
    ORDER BY ROWNUM ASC
   )
   WHERE RECNO = 2

     結(jié)果為:

   ID NAME
    05 fifth

4.抽出按某種方式排序的記錄集中的第M條記錄開(kāi)始的X條記錄

   3里所講得僅僅是抽取一條記錄的情況,當(dāng)我們需要抽取多條記錄的時(shí)候,此時(shí)在2中的N的取值應(yīng)該是在N >= (M + X - 1)這個(gè)范圍內(nèi),當(dāng)讓最經(jīng)濟(jì)的取值就是取等好的時(shí)候了的時(shí)候了。當(dāng)然最后的抽取條件也不是RECNO = N了,應(yīng)該是RECNO BETWEEN M AND (M + X - 1)了,所以隨之而來(lái)的SQL語(yǔ)句則為:

SELECT 列名1...列名n FROM
  (
   SELECT ROWNUM RECNO, 列名1...列名nFROM
   (
   SELECT 列名1...列名n FROM 表名 ORDER BY 列名1...列名n)
   WHERE ROWNUM = N (N >= (M + X - 1))
  ORDER BY ROWNUM ASC
   )
   WHERE RECNO BETWEEN M AND (M + X - 1)
  同樣以上面的數(shù)據(jù)為例,則抽取NAME的字母順的第2條記錄開(kāi)始的3條記錄的SQL語(yǔ)句為:
  SELECT ID, NAME FROM
   (
   SELECT ROWNUM RECNO, ID, NAME FROM
    (SELECT * FROM CUSTOMER ORDER BY NAME)
   WHERE ROWNUM = (2 + 3 - 1)
   ORDER BY ROWNUM ASC
   )
   WHERE RECNO BETWEEN 2 AND (2 + 3 - 1)

     結(jié)果如下:

   ID NAME
    05 fifth
    01 first
    04 forth

    以此為基礎(chǔ),再擴(kuò)展的話,做成存儲(chǔ)過(guò)程,將開(kāi)始記錄數(shù)以及抽取記錄數(shù)為參數(shù),就可以輕松實(shí)現(xiàn)分頁(yè)抽取數(shù)據(jù)。

   當(dāng)然了,上面所講的都是一些最基本的,實(shí)際應(yīng)用中往往都沒(méi)有這么簡(jiǎn)單,但是不管怎么說(shuō),不管復(fù)雜的應(yīng)用總是由這些簡(jiǎn)單的元素構(gòu)成,掌握一些最基本的方法始終是重要的。

以上所述是小編給大家介紹的在ORACLE中實(shí)現(xiàn)SELECT TOP N的方法,希望對(duì)大家有所幫助,如果大家有任何疑問(wèn)請(qǐng)給我留言,小編會(huì)及時(shí)回復(fù)大家的。在此也非常感謝大家對(duì)腳本之家網(wǎng)站的支持!

您可能感興趣的文章:
  • 最簡(jiǎn)單的Oracle數(shù)據(jù)恢復(fù) select as of使用方法
  • oracle select執(zhí)行順序的詳解
  • 解析oracle對(duì)select加鎖的方法以及鎖的查詢(xún)
  • 在oracle 數(shù)據(jù)庫(kù)查詢(xún)的select 查詢(xún)字段中關(guān)聯(lián)其他表的方法

標(biāo)簽:寧波 百色 昭通 紹興 遼源 自貢 海東 中衛(wèi)

巨人網(wǎng)絡(luò)通訊聲明:本文標(biāo)題《在ORACLE中SELECT TOP N的實(shí)現(xiàn)方法》,本文關(guān)鍵詞  在,ORACLE,中,SELECT,TOP,的,;如發(fā)現(xiàn)本文內(nèi)容存在版權(quán)問(wèn)題,煩請(qǐng)?zhí)峁┫嚓P(guān)信息告之我們,我們將及時(shí)溝通與處理。本站內(nèi)容系統(tǒng)采集于網(wǎng)絡(luò),涉及言論、版權(quán)與本站無(wú)關(guān)。
  • 相關(guān)文章
  • 下面列出與本文章《在ORACLE中SELECT TOP N的實(shí)現(xiàn)方法》相關(guān)的同類(lèi)信息!
  • 本頁(yè)收集關(guān)于在ORACLE中SELECT TOP N的實(shí)現(xiàn)方法的相關(guān)信息資訊供網(wǎng)民參考!
  • 推薦文章
    www.日韩高清| 亚洲视频在线观看视频| www婷婷av久久久影片| 88久久精品无码一区二区毛片| 日韩精品在线网站| 亚洲欧洲一区二区三区在线观看| 欧美精品一区二区三区很污很色的| 9l视频自拍蝌蚪9l视频成人| 成人18免费入口| jizz18日本| 亚洲一区二区在线视频观看| 97超级在线观看免费高清完整版电视剧| 九九热这里只有在线精品视| 香蕉视频网站入口| 中文字幕亚洲在线| 色偷偷久久人人79超碰人人澡| 国产精品美女久久久久久| a在线观看免费| 国产视频网址在线| 可以直接看的黄色网址| 欧美男人的天堂一二区| 欧美精品久久96人妻无码| 国产欧美一级| 鲁鲁在线中文| 蜜臀av.com| 九九综合久久| 日本中文字幕在线2020| 99电影网电视剧在线观看| 女人爱爱视频| 久久精品久久精品亚洲人| 波多野结衣av在线免费观看| 日韩av在线网| 亚洲欧美国产精品专区久久| 欧美日韩国产成人在线观看| 国产视频丨精品|在线观看| 国产精品成人无码专区| 精品少妇人妻av一区二区三区| 亚洲人成网站777色婷婷| yiren22亚洲综合伊人22| 久久一本精品| 美腿丝袜亚洲图片| 日韩欧美综合| 亚洲激情视频一区| 日本黄色免费网站| 天天摸夜夜添狠狠添婷婷| 欧美野外多人交3| 久久伦理中文字幕| 男人插女人欧美| 国产九色91回来了| 九一国产精品| 欧美国产禁国产网站cc| 伊人久久大香线蕉综合热线| 91精品国产91久久综合桃花| 校园春色亚洲色图| 91gao视频| 欧美videossex| 欧美日韩在线观看一区二区| 污视频在线观看免费网站| 国产午夜一区二区三区| 国精品无码一区二区三区| 久久密一区二区三区| 国产精品永久入口久久久| 在线成人精品视频| 91麻豆精品91久久久久久清纯| 国产福利资源在线| 久久精品国产一区二区三区日韩| 欧美疯狂性受xxxxx另类| jvid一区二区三区| av网站在线观看不卡| 亚洲无线一线二线三线区别av| 国产精品久久久久久在线观看| 老头吃奶性行交视频| 五月天综合网站| 国产偷窥老熟盗摄视频| 在线亚洲午夜片av大片| 激情影院在线观看| 日韩一级片免费观看| 最新欧美人z0oozo0| 丰满少妇中文字幕| 99久久99久久久精品棕色圆| 美洲天堂一区二卡三卡四卡视频| 欧美国产精品日韩| 欧美精品日本| www.com亚洲| 成人黄页毛片网站| 欧美成人高清视频在线观看| 日韩在线观看免费全| 91香蕉嫩草影院入口| a毛片在线播放| 国产麻豆免费观看| 国产一区二区三区精彩视频| 美女网站一区二区| 成人影视在线播放| 久久久久99精品成人片三人毛片| 欧美日韩亚洲综合一区二区三区激情在线| 国产福利在线视频| 国产高潮免费视频| 国产成人免费精品| 制服丝袜影音先锋| 欧美丝袜丝交足nylons| 国产精品一区二区三区久久久| 黄色片子免费| 亚洲日本欧美天堂| 黄污视频在线看| 一级做a爱片性色毛片| 人九九综合九九宗合| 欧美日韩国产免费观看视频| 欧美区一区二区| 91精品人妻一区二区三区果冻| 国产精品果冻传媒潘| 亚洲综合视频在线观看| 免费aⅴ网站| 日本怡春院一区二区| 新片速递亚洲合集欧美合集| 欧美日韩中文字幕综合视频| 99a精品视频在线观看| 欧美一区二区三区性视频| 国产高清美女一级毛片久久| 国产精品扒开腿做爽爽爽男男| 久热国产精品视频一区二区三区| 国产精品吊钟奶在线| 中文字幕91| 亚洲黄色影院| 性8sex亚洲区入口| 免费不卡视频| 精品福利二区三区| 久久久久久久久久av| 夜夜夜精品看看| 99免费精品在线观看| 欧美日韩午夜影院| jizz性欧美2| 91精品二区| 婷婷中文字幕在线观看| 91免费观看视频在线| 久久综合电影一区| 午夜国产在线观看| 伊人久久大香线蕉午夜av| 国产小视频在线免费观看| 成人网免费视频| 国产在线观看免费播放| 99久久人妻无码中文字幕系列| 成人影院在线视频| 6699久久国产精品免费| 国产对白叫床清晰在线播放| 亚洲一区免费视频| 欧美亚洲黄色| 成人台湾亚洲精品一区二区| 来吧亚洲综合网| 久久久精品人妻一区二区三区| 91久久中文字幕| 不卡av日日日| 国产精品一区二区三区免费观看| 一本久道久久综合狠狠爱亚洲精品| 欧洲美熟女乱又伦| 性亚洲最疯狂xxxx高清| 久久91超碰青草在哪里看| 欧美一区二区三区久久久| 91成人国产在线观看| 欧美一区二区视频| 国产精品一区二区三区在线播放| 国产综合欧美| va婷婷在线免费观看| 中字幕一区二区三区乱码| 精品一区中文字幕| 日本午夜一区二区| 91福利视频在线观看| 欧美日韩三级一区| 五月天久久久| 日本午夜精品视频在线观看| 91av毛片| 性生交大片免费看l| 亚洲免费视频网| 欧美一区不卡| 国产欧美一区二区三区久久人妖| 欧美俄罗斯性视频| 亚洲一区二区三区中文字幕在线观看| 国产欧美va欧美va香蕉在线| 美女色狠狠久久| 岛国视频午夜一区免费在线观看| 精品176极品一区| www.视频在线.com| 成人av电影天堂| 香蕉视频在线观看黄| 亚洲va欧美va人人爽成人影院| 激情综合色综合久久| 亚洲 欧美 变态 另类 综合| 国产精品入口免费视频一| 久久精品久久久久久国产 免费| 亚洲国产成人在线视频| 性欧美办公室18xxxxhd| 国产欧美成人| 亚洲成人av福利| 日本成人免费网站| 天天综合一区| 国产成人亚洲精品青草天美| 精品成a人在线观看| 成人97精品毛片免费看| 亚洲黄色成人网| 亚洲免费999| 激情小说 在线视频| 91蝌蚪国产九色| 国产亚洲美女久久| 亚洲一区二区三区四区在线播放| 美日韩免费视频| 国产又大又黄又粗又爽| 久久免费少妇高潮99精品| 国产又黄又猛又粗| 51视频国产精品一区二区| 黑粗硬大欧美视频| 91小视频在线播放| 欧美成a人片免费观看久久五月天| 天堂av手机在线| 老牛影视精品| 国产aⅴ精品一区二区三区色成熟| av在线不卡一区| 日韩欧美精品在线不卡| 性爱视频在线播放| 亚洲精品tv久久久久久久久久| 搞黄视频在线观看| 欧美va亚洲va在线观看蝴蝶网| 免费在线观看的毛片| 欧美午夜aaaaaa免费视频| 日韩高清在线| wwwcom羞羞网站| 亚洲奶水xxxx哺乳期| 黄页网站在线免费观看| 亚洲精品视频在线观看免费| 一个人看的视频www| 成人国产精品av| 欧美白人最猛性xxxxx69交| 激情伊人五月天久久综合| silk一区二区三区精品视频| 久久亚洲美女| 99精品老司机免费视频| 天天干天天操天天操| 国产成人中文字幕| 欧美人与物videos另类xxxxx| 成人动漫在线一区| www.欧美精品一二区| 久久av超碰| 日韩精品免费在线播放| 少妇高潮一区二区三区喷水| 99精品视频在线观看免费| 日韩精品免费一区二区在线观看| 成人免费黄色av| 两个人看的在线视频www| 国产按摩一区二区三区| 男女一区二区三区免费| 久久久久国产精品夜夜夜夜夜| 亚洲欧洲美洲国产香蕉| 最好看的2019的中文字幕视频| 欧美xxxxx少妇| 91老司机在线| 国产免费av国片精品草莓男男| 亚洲老妇色熟女老太| 首页亚洲欧美制服丝腿| 日韩福利视频在线| 中文字幕精品一区二区精品| 精品日韩一区二区三区| 国产视频不卡一区| 久久中文亚洲字幕| 亚洲精品在线国产| 日韩女优av电影在线观看| 亚洲视频在线观看| 精品久久99ma| 国产视频在线观看一区| 97精品视频在线观看自产线路二| gogo大胆日本视频一区| 一区二区三区四区国产| 亚洲成人免费av| 欧美aaaaa性bbbbb小妇| 精品人人视频| 一级黄色片网址| 91麻豆精品在线观看| 国产一区二区区别| 精品在线播放| 四虎成人免费观看在线网址| 国产91精品久久久久久| 黄色国产小视频| 日本人妖在线| 精品一区二区免费在线观看| 色偷偷综合社区| 狠狠色噜噜狠狠狠狠97| 欧美高清在线视频观看不卡| 精品视频高潮| 久久丁香综合五月国产三级网站| www.99久久热国产日韩欧美.com| 免费成人高清在线视频theav| 国产激情一区二区三区四区| 精品少妇v888av| 一女被多男玩喷潮视频| 九九热精品在线视频| 日本网站在线免费观看| 国产欧美日韩在线| 天天射天天爱天天射干| 国产女18毛片多18精品| 麻豆精品视频在线观看视频| 69视频在线观看免费| 亚洲欧美一区二区三| 精品福利一区二区三区免费视频| 久久精品99久久久香蕉| 2022国产精品视频| 国产情侣一区二区| 亚洲人成无码网站久久99热国产| 成人福利电影| 日韩a级作爱片一二三区免费观看| 三级做a全过程在线观看| aaa级黄色片| 亚洲黄网站在线观看| 三级黄色在线观看| 中国人体摄影一区二区三区| 日韩电影免费网址| 日本欧美一二三区| 可以免费看的av毛片| 人妻夜夜添夜夜无码av| 国产探花在线视频| 国产在亚洲线视频观看| 欧美色视频日本版| 在线一区免费观看| 国产成人免费在线观看不卡| 成人资源视频网站免费| 亚洲七七久久综合桃花剧情介绍| 色综合久久综合网欧美综合网| 69av视频在线播放| 久久综合之合合综合久久| 91精品国产综合久久香蕉的特点| 色av综合在线| 激情久久综合网|